Ket yang di perlukan untuk artikel ini gambar bentuk formnya dapat di sesuaikan pada tampilan gambar ... Selamat mencoba..
Untuk membuat
bentuk bangun ini hal yang perlu diperhatikan adalah formula dari bangun
tersebut.
A. Bentuk Lingkaran
Dalam membuat program aplikasi bentuk lingkaran anda pertama
kali membuat tampilannya terlebih dahulu seperti yang terlihat pada gambar 2.1
Langkah
kedua yaitu merubah properties dari tampilan yang telah dibuat dengan jalan
merubah nilai yang terdapat pada objek seperti terlihat pada tabel 2.1.
Tabel 2.1. Perubahan yang dilakukan
pada windows properties
Objek
|
Properti
|
Nilai (Value)
|
Form1
|
Caption
|
Lingkaran
|
Command1
|
Caption
|
&Hitung
|
Command2
|
Caption
|
H&apus
|
Cammand3
|
Caption
|
K&eluar
|
Label1
|
Caption
|
Perhitungan Lingkaran
|
Label2
|
Caption
|
Diameter
|
Label3
|
Caption
|
Keliling
|
Label4
|
Caption
|
Luas
|
Text1
|
Text
|
(kosongkan)
|
Text2
|
Text
|
(kosongkan)
|
Text3
|
Text
|
(kosongkan)
|
Langkah ketiga
yaitu membuat kode program aplikasi tetapi sebelumnya anda harus sudah
mengetahui rumus-rumus yang akan digunakan untuk program aplikasi ini yaitu
rumus keliling lingkaran dan Luas lingkaran serta tanda-tanda untuk operasi
matematika (tabel 2.2).
Tabel 2.2.
Operasi Matematika
Tanda Operasi
Matematika Untuk Visual Basic 6.0
|
Keterangan
|
+
|
Penjumlahan
|
-
|
Pengurangan
|
/
|
Pembagian
|
*
|
Perkalian
|
^
|
Pangkat
|
Untuk rumus keliling lingkaran adalah
(π x diameter^2 ) / 4 dan rumus Luas
lingkaran adalah π x diameter.
Pada tampilan program aplikasi yang
anda buat diameter yang diisi terletak pada Text1, Keliling terletak pada Text2
dan Luas terletak pada Text3 maka rumus-rumus diatas berubah menjadi:
Untuk Keliling lingkaran berubah :
Text2.Text = 3.14 * Text1.Text
Untuk Luas lingkaran berubah :
Text3.Text = (3.14 * Text1.Text^2) / 4
Tahapan Untuk Membuat Kode program
adalah
- Klik
dua kali pada Command1 (Untuk Hitung)
Private Sub Command1_Click()
Text3.Text = ( 3.14* Text1.Text ^ 2) / 4 ‘Perhitungan Luas Lingkaran
Text2.Text = 3.14 * Text1.Text
‘Perhitungan Keliling Lingkaran
End Sub
- Klik dua kali pada Command2 (Untuk
Hapus)
Private Sub Command2_Click()
Text1.Text = ""
Text2.Text = ""
Text3.Text = ""
End Sub
- Klik
dua kali pada Command3 (Untuk Keluar)
Private Sub Command3_Click()
End
End Sub
B.
Memodifikasi
Kode Program
Untuk memodifikasi kode program berarti anda merubah tampilan program
aplikasinya, untuk itu ubahlah apliksi diatas menjadi seperti dibawah ini.
Yaitu dengan menambahkan komponen objek 1 Frame, 2 OptionButton dan 2 CheckBox.
Objek
|
Properti
|
Nilai (Value)
|
Frame1
|
Caption
|
Pilihan
|
Option1
|
Caption
|
Biru
|
Option2
|
Caption
|
Hijau
|
Check1
|
Caption
|
Tebal
|
Check2
|
Caption
|
Miring
|
Objek Frame1 dibuat terlebih
dahulu di form, dan selanjutnya Option dan Check di buat di dalam Frame1. Tujuan
dari ini sebagi pilihan di program aplikasi.
Tambahkan Kode Program berikut ini:
- Klik Ganda
pada Option1 kemudian ketik kode berikut:
Private Sub
Option1_Click()
Text1.ForeColor = vbBlue
Text2.ForeColor = vbBlue
Text3.ForeColor = vbBlue
End Sub
- Klik Ganda
pada Option2 kemudian ketik kode berikut:
Private Sub
Option2_Click()
Text1.ForeColor = vbGreen
Text2.ForeColor = vbGreen
Text3.ForeColor = vbGreen
End Sub
- Klik Ganda pada Check1 kemudian ketik kode berikut:
Private Sub
Check1_Click()
Text1.FontBold = Check1.Value
Text2.FontBold = Check1.Value
Text3.FontBold = Check1.Value
End Sub
- Klik Ganda pada Check2 kemudian ketik kode berikut:
Private Sub
Check2_Click()
Text1.FontItalic = Check2.Value
Text2.FontItalic = Check2.Value
Text3.FontItalic = Check2.Value
End Sub
Kemudian simpan Form1,
kemudian jalankan program aplikasi ini dan lihta hasilnya:
C.
Bentuk yang
lain yang dapat dibuat
Dengan
mengikuti langkah-langkah yang telah dilakukan anda dapat membuat perhitungan
untuk bentuk lainnya. Tampilan dari perhitungan dapat anda buat dengan selera.
Hal yang perlu di perhatikan adalah anda harus mengerti rumus dan perubahan
rumus kedalam aplikasi program yang akan di buat pada visual basic 6.0.
No comments:
Post a Comment